MySQL
MySQL是一个开源的关系型数据库管理系统,其功能强大且易于使用。它可以管理大量的数据,同时具有高可用性和可扩展性。MySQL在网站开发中被广泛应用,很多网站都是基于MySQL构建的。
用户登录记录
用户登录记录是指记录用户登录系统的信息,例如登录时间、登录IP地址等。这些信息对于系统管理和安全监控非常重要,可以用来查看用户行为、分析系统性能等。
在MySQL中,我们可以使用如下SQL语句来查询用户登录记录:
```
SELECT * FROM login_record WHERE user_id = 'xxx';
此语句将查询login_record表中所有用户ID为'xxx'的数据记录。
查找用户登录记录
找到用户登录记录需要使用正确的查询语句。我们可以根据时间范围、用户ID、登录状态等条件来过滤查询结果。要查找最近24小时内用户ID为'xxx'的登录记录,可以使用如下SQL语句:
SELECT * FROM login_record WHERE user_id = 'xxx' AND login_time >= DATE_SUB(NOW(), INTERVAL 1 DAY);
该语句将查询login_record表中最近24小时内所有用户ID为'xxx'的数据记录。
记录用户登录信息
为了记录用户的登录信息,我们需要在系统中添加相应的代码。可以在用户登录成功后,在数据库中插入一条记录。可以使用如下PHP代码实现:
$pdo = new PDO('mysql:host=localhost;dbname=mydb', 'username', 'password');
$sql = "INSERT INTO login_record (user_id, login_time, login_ip) VALUES (:user_id, :login_time, :login_ip)";
$stmt = $pdo->prepare($sql);
$stmt->execute(array(
'user_id' => $user_id,
'login_time' => date('Y-m-d H:i:s'),
'login_ip' => $_SERVER['REMOTE_ADDR']
));
该代码将在login_record表中插入一条记录,记录用户ID、登录时间和登录IP地址。
MySQL数据库
MySQL数据库是一款优秀的数据库系统,其功能强大、可靠、易于使用。它广泛应用于Web应用程序和其他大型企业级应用程序中。MySQL的优点包括高度可扩展性、高性能、易于维护和管理等。
数据库管理
数据库管理是指对数据库进行管理和维护。它包括创建和修改数据库、创建和修改数据库表、添加和修改数据、备份和恢复数据库等操作。在MySQL中,可以使用命令行工具或可视化工具进行数据库管理。
数据安全
数据安全是指数据库中数据的保密性和完整性。数据库管理人员需要采取措施来保护数据库中的数据,防止数据泄露和损坏等风险。常见的数据安全措施包括数据备份、数据加密、访问控制等。
网友留言(0)